Setting up MSI Afterburner

First, poke the Settings button at the bottom of the program panel:

At the top of the window that appears:

  1. select the "Monitoring" tab;
  2. put a check mark on the items of the list that we want to monitor. Drag the lines with the mouse in the order in which you want them to be displayed in the game;
  3. while the line item is highlighted, it can be assigned - whether it will be displayed in the EOS during the game or not (and at the same time the color, name, and other properties).

As you can see, in the screenshot, the Frame Rate is not checked, but usually you need to mark it, unless your FPS is displayed by the game itself, or by another program.

Configuring the MSI Afterburner EOS

So, to configure the display of FPS and monitoring data during the game, in the same settings panel, find the EOS tab, and there - the "Advanced" button. Klats her!

The window for setting up the EOS has opened. In it, you must do the following things:

  1. Make sure the EOS display switch is in the ON position (if not, you know what to do!).
  2. Optional: turn it on if suddenly the anti-cheat in the game swears.
  3. Optional: affects the way of displaying (roughly speaking, the font) of the EOS. It is best to choose Raster 3D, there you can customize the font by clicking on the Raster 3D inscription again.
  4. It is better to turn on the shadow of the font (switch it to ON).
  5. Choose the color of the EDM font to your taste!
  6. Squares at the corners of the monitor - quick way move the EOS to the desired corner of the monitor. Or you can just drag the EOS with the mouse, or set its coordinates manually.

Why can video cards be overclocked?

The company (conditionally Nvidia), after manufacturing a small batch of graphics cards, conducts a stress resistance test and overclocking limits, and then simply sets the same stable values ​​for all released video cards.

The manufacturer simply cannot check every video card made for overclocking resistance. It simply sets the bar on the value at which the tested video cards perform flawlessly. And it may well be that the video card installed in your PC is capable of demonstrating high overclocking rates. Security

The logical question is whether it is dangerous. After all, we increase the indicators tested and recommended by the manufacturer. This is not entirely true. Sometimes it happens that the manufacturers themselves recommend overclocking the video card a little when they realize that they are "cheap" and set too low values.

Even when overclocking is not recommended by the manufacturer, it can still be done. All modern video cards are protected by various technologies, the meaning of which boils down to the following: when it overheats, it simply turns off and resets the overclocking values ​​to their original level. The same will happen if you overdo it and set the acceleration values ​​too high. The computer will restart and reset the graphics card settings you made.

But still the main question when using MSI Afterburner: "How to overclock a video card?" Therefore, let's take a closer look at the overclocking sliders in more detail:

  • Core Voltage (mV) - (English "core voltage") - this parameter is responsible for The more energy is supplied, the higher the temperature and the more you can raise the frequency of the video card.
  • Power Limit (%) - this setting sets the threshold for enabling the protective technology - throttling. During the game, if suddenly the video card begins to exceed this parameter, throttling is turned on and resets the frequencies to standard, and sometimes even lower levels. People who ask a question about how to use MSI Afterburner, and are only getting acquainted with the program, should know that excessively exceeding the permissible limits (which can be read about on the official websites of the video card manufacturer) leads to problems, although often Power Limit is blocked and unavailable for editing.
  • Temp Limit - this parameter sets the temperature threshold, after which the video card will turn on throttling, that is, it works like a Power Limit, only with temperature, not power.
  • Core Clock (MHz) - the most important slider for overclocking. It is worth increasing its values ​​carefully, by 10-15 points, each time saving and checking the performance of new frequencies in graphic applications.
  • Memory Clock (MHz) - (English "memory frequency"). When overclocking, it is worth remembering that it is almost useless to overclock Memory clock - this parameter does not affect performance without overclocking, nor does Core clock.
  • Fan speed (%) - slider for adjusting the cooler on the video card.

Normal temperature of components

In what limits should the temperature be kept for various components.

Processor

  • Up to 42 o C. Processor idle.
  • Up to 65 - 70 o C (depending on the model). Under load.
  • Up to 61 - 72 o C (depending on model). Recommended maximum.
  • 94 - 105 o C. Turning on throttling - performance degradation.
  • More than 105 o C. Turns off the computer to prevent burning.

Please note that these metrics are subject to constant change as technology changes. If you need to find out the exact information on a specific processor, you can use the tips in various programs, for example, in the Core Temp presented above:

Thus, these numbers are conditional - the norm depends on the manufacturer (Intel, AMD ...) and specific model... Also, the norm for most laptop processors is lower. It is most correct to go to the page of a particular processor and see its temperature rate.

Video cards

To a greater extent, the operating temperature of a video card depends on its class - for an accurate determination, it is worth studying the documentation. Average indicators are approximately as follows:

  • Up to 45 o C. In idle mode.
  • Up to 85 o C. Under load.
  • Up to 100 o C. Recommended maximum.

Above 100 o C, the video card starts the throttling process and, if it does not help, turns off the computer.

Disk

  • Up to 45 o C. In idle mode.
  • Up to 53 o C. Maximum recommended.

At temperatures above 53 degrees, the shock absorption of the disk increases significantly, which leads to an acceleration of its failure. Maximum allowable threshold SSD drives slightly higher and can reach 70 degrees.

The minimum operating temperature of the disk should be within 24-26 degrees. At lower rates, damage is possible. Therefore, if we brought a cold medium from the street, we should not immediately use it in work. Thus, the comfortable temperature for the disc is between 25 and 45 degrees Celsius.

These figures are valid for both internal and external disks, since, in fact, the latter are the same disks placed in separate boxes.

Consequences of overheating

As mentioned above, overheating of components can cause various kinds of problems. Possible overheating can be judged by the following symptoms:

  1. Slow down your computer. To prevent burnout and shutdown, the processor and video card start the process of throttling. In fact, they begin to work with underestimated indicators, which leads, on the one hand, to a decrease in heat generation, on the other, to a decrease in productivity.
  2. Excessive noise. Most often, controlled fans are installed in the computer, which begin to rotate faster when the temperature rises. Of course, this leads to an increase in the noise level.
  3. Spontaneous shutdown computer. To prevent the final combustion, the device signals to stop the power supply, which leads to an abrupt shutdown of the PC. This is an extreme measure.
  4. Colored figures (artifacts) appear on the screen. A typical symptom when a video card overheats.
  5. Sagging FPS in games. A special case slowing down your PC.
  6. Hot case. As a rule, this can be seen only for monoblocks and laptops.
  7. Blue Screen of Death (BSOD). In rare cases, the system generates a stop error.

Causes of overheating and how to lower the temperature

Let's look at the reasons when the temperature of the components starts to go beyond the permissible range.

  1. Dust. More often than not, the dirt inside system unit or laptop is causing poor thermal conductivity and temperature rise. To solve the problem, disassemble the computer and blow out the dust using a can of compressed air.
  2. Hot air builds up inside the case. To begin with, you can try opening the side cover of the computer, if it helps - install an additional fan on the side wall. You can buy a cooling pad for your laptop.
  3. Drying of thermal paste. We remove the processor cooler, erase the remaining thermal paste and apply a new layer.
  4. Poor fan performance. If they rotate weakly, the cooling efficiency will be lower than expected. You can measure the fan speed using the above programs, for example, SpeedFan. Fans can be cleaned from dust, lubricated, replaced.
  5. The close arrangement of components to each other. Iron can warm each other. If there is room, it is worth placing the disks at a great distance from each other, the same applies to video cards. Inside the case, all wires should be neatly bent around the edges, leaving a lot of space in the center for effective air circulation.
  6. High ambient temperature. In summer, more cooling is required. It is also worth keeping the computer away from batteries or other sources of heat.
  7. Power supply problem. If the power supply is too high, overheating will be observed. You can measure the voltage using the utilities described above, for example, AIDA64 or HWMonitor. If the voltage is exceeded, we will try to connect the computer to another power source or replace the power supply.
  8. Inefficient Windows Power Mode. If the power supply operating mode is set to maximum performance, it is worth trying to set it balanced.
  9. Overheating of the power supply. Some models of power supplies have a blowing fan towards the processor, which worsens the effect of the cooling system of the latter.
